I dont think having a team means a faster development, see, one of the developers that delivers the biggest amount of content is Dr. Pinkcake, hes a solo developer. Ocean also releases a lot of content, even more considering hes producing 2 games at the same time. Now take Oppai Man's example (Fresh Women developer), he has a team working for him, at this point we can say they are a company, yet their updates has small amount of content and cant match Ocean or Dr. Pinkcake update size...i remember they even downgraded their renders with A.I some time ago...and they have people working and make a lot of money.
About being burned out, having a team doesnt means this will not happen, each member has their own work to do and it can still happen, i know they can hire someone else but the quality of the work can change and having more people brings some work-relationship problems, ppl in this field tend to not be the best ones to work with.
I personally think that Ocean and Pinkcake being solo developers is what gives their games the chance of reaching the end, because they seem to have the drive to finish it, i would add Nyx (Intertwined) to this mix too.

Hello,

With this Dev Log, we return to the old Bi-weekly Wednesday Dev log schedule.

So... after the last log, some complained that I didn't give as much info regarding the render count, etc.

I heard ya and from now on I will ban everyone who asks me that.

Of course, I'm just kidding and will, from now on, provide a bi-weekly render count + a total.

The reason why I stopped doing it is because a lot of expectations come with them.

The irony is, no matter how many renders I add, it's always too little.

People go ham with the conspiracy theories if there's a discrepancy between two weeks.

I could post a render count every week with the same amount of images added, and people would still find a way to uncover "the truth".

It's exhausting.

However, I like to be transparent, and a render total is a part of it.

The last total render count was mentioned on the 19th of December, just short of Christmas. I took it easier over Christmas and created all the Christmas Treats.

~3750 renders -> ~4790 (+ a hundred in the queue)

-------------------------
12 days ago, I said I'd count how many renders I do between Dev Logs to see how much the Workstation improves productivity.

I won't count two of these days because the first day was already over, and I took one day to care for some personal relationships.

Previously, I'd do and render around 20-40 daily renders and zero animations. (Animations would lock down the PC for the entire day.)

So, in 10 days of work with the new Workstation, I created AND rendered out:
641 still renders
7 animations.

It went from:
~300 to 671 images
0 to 7 animations.


I didn't completely reach my goal of 70 renders a day. (Average of 64).

However, new environments and giant scenes make this impossible if you want to maintain quality. Sometimes, I can only set up 20-40 images, while other times, I reach 80-100.

From now on, I aim for 70 renders a day, but I won't beat myself up if it's "only" 40-50. I still have my quality to maintain and improve.

The workstation peaked at 78 images a night the other day, and with that, it outperforms me, which is fantastic.

My old Workstation will render animations until they're all done.

Keep in mind that not all renders are exclusively for SG.
